Hi Claude, Are you using D for deep discharge? That's more intended for testing batteries than recalibrating them - it discharges the battery to 6V instead of 6.5 Volts. I'd use the F option which creates a log on your Flash Disk that you could send to me if it's not behaving. You can also recalibrate the battery by simply using the unit unplugged until you get a battery critical message, and then plugging it back in until it recharges fully. If it doesn't calibrate after either of those, there may be a problem with the battery, and it might need servicing.
